Step 1: Import the Object
The first step is to import the 3D model or object that you want to apply the rotating effect to. You can either create your own 3D model using 3D modeling software or find one from online repositories. Once you have the object ready, import it into your Unity project and position it in the desired location.
Step 2: Add a Rotation Script
Next, you'll need to create a script that will handle the rotation of the object. In Unity, you can write scripts using C# to add custom behavior to your objects. Create a new C# script and attach it to the object you want to rotate. Within the script, you can define the rotation speed and axis to achieve the desired effect.
Step 3: Define the Rotation Behavior
With the script in place, you can define the rotation behavior based on your specific requirements. You can choose to rotate the object continuously in one direction, create a smooth oscillating motion, or even add interactive controls to allow users to manipulate the rotation themselves. By customizing the rotation behavior, you can tailor the effect to suit your project's unique aesthetic and functional needs.
Step 4: Test and Refine
Once you have implemented the rotation script and defined the desired behavior, it's time to test the effect in the Unity editor. Make sure to run the project and observe the rotation of the object from different angles and distances. This step is crucial for fine-tuning the rotation speed, axis, and overall visual impact of the effect.
